(Filed Under wholesale Lingerie News). Adore Me has just introduced Joyja period panties, which it describes as “an inclusive and affordable brand of period panties working to improve the access of period products for menstruating people in the U.S. living below the poverty line.”
The new panties, which are priced at $20 a pair, are marketed under the tagline “The Happy Period Panties,” and are sized from XS to 4X. “Joyja panties look and feel like real underwear but absorb up to two tampons’ worth. They’re machine-washable, reusable, simple to care for, and come in a variety of styles and colors.”
In announcing the move the company explained, “Joyja wants to bring more joy to “that time of the month” with bright colors, quirky prints, easy usage, and a significantly lower environmental impact than plastic tampons and pads.” The company emphasized that for every pair of panties purchased, Adore Me will donate a pair to someone in need within the U.S. through distribution partners like Girls Inc. and Los Angeles LGBT Center.”
